Virgin has hired Steve Levy to join the company's festival division as chief marketing officer, it was announced Monday.
In his new role, he will oversee all sales and marketing. Levy, a multi-faceted media executive with extensive international experience, will be based out of Virgin's Los Angeles office.
He joins the company from Insomniac Events, where he served as head of marketing and digital since 2017. During his time there, he oversaw significant year-over-year growth of all of the company's major festivals, including a first-time, full sellout on-sale for EDC Las Vegas 2020.
